type CreateIndexTask struct {
	client         *Client
	collectionName string
	fieldName      string
	indexName      string
	interval       time.Duration
}

func (t *CreateIndexTask) Await(ctx context.Context) error {
	ticker := time.NewTicker(t.interval)
	defer ticker.Stop()
	for {
		select {
		case <-ticker.C:
			finished := false
			err := t.client.callService(func(milvusService milvuspb.MilvusServiceClient) error {
				resp, err := milvusService.DescribeIndex(ctx, &milvuspb.DescribeIndexRequest{
					CollectionName: t.collectionName,
					FieldName:      t.fieldName,
					IndexName:      t.indexName,
				})
				err = merr.CheckRPCCall(resp, err)
				if err != nil {
					return err
				}

				for _, info := range resp.GetIndexDescriptions() {
					if (t.indexName == "" && info.GetFieldName() == t.fieldName) || t.indexName == info.GetIndexName() {
						switch info.GetState() {
						case commonpb.IndexState_Finished:
							finished = true
							return nil
						case commonpb.IndexState_Failed:
							return fmt.Errorf("create index failed, reason: %s", info.GetIndexStateFailReason())
						}
					}
				}
				return nil
			})
			if err != nil {
				return err
			}
			if finished {
				return nil
			}
			ticker.Reset(t.interval)
		case <-ctx.Done():
			return ctx.Err()
		}
	}
}

func (c *Client) CreateIndex(ctx context.Context, option CreateIndexOption, callOptions ...grpc.CallOption) (*CreateIndexTask, error) {
	req := option.Request()
	var task *CreateIndexTask

	err := c.callService(func(milvusService milvuspb.MilvusServiceClient) error {
		resp, err := milvusService.CreateIndex(ctx, req, callOptions...)
		if err = merr.CheckRPCCall(resp, err); err != nil {
			return err
		}

		task = &CreateIndexTask{
			client:         c,
			collectionName: req.GetCollectionName(),
			fieldName:      req.GetFieldName(),
			indexName:      req.GetIndexName(),
			interval:       time.Millisecond * 100,
		}

		return nil
	})

	return task, err
}
